Remarkable Washington county gas field study reveals limits

The Disratcn special commissioner details Washington county gas territory with high rock pressure wells and undeveloped acres. Findings show extending Hickory Canonsburg districts may yield gas with larger mains and higher pipelines. Cost, uncertain results, and disputed coal gas relationships drive cautious expansion.

Fire destroys Knowles Taylor Knowles pottery works in East Liverpool

A gas explosion at the Knowles Taylor Knowles china works leveled the factory in East Liverpool, killing no one but injuring a worker who fell from a skylight. With $250,000 total loss and only $30,000 insured, the plant will be rebuilt, taking about a year, while two neighboring factories survived and operations resume.

Windom Considers Reducing Deposits in Banks for Bonds

Secretary Windom denied reports that he will withdraw all United States deposits from major city banks. He says he is weighing reducing deposits and using funds to buy bonds, with about 47 million dollars currently on deposit.

Jefferson Davis in deteriorating health in New Orleans

New Orleans reports Mr Jefferson Davis much worse with fever rising to 101. He remained weak and restless from early morning. By evening his fever subsided slightly but he was still in worse condition than the previous day. Only the doctor his wife and Mrs Fenner may enter his room.

Conference of Virginia Colored Leaders Planned in Richmond

In Petersburg on November 18 a call goes out for a conference of Virginia’s prominent colored men to meet in Richmond on December 17 to discuss the condition of colored people politically and otherwise. A committee may be formed to visit Washington to press Congress for a national election law.

Bloodista Revelation Details in Rio De Janeiro Decree

From Rio de Janeiro a government decree outlines five articles. The Republic is proclaimed and the deposed emperor is granted 800 contes de reis per annum for life. The decree covers Brazil’s provinces uniting into a federal state.

Knights of Labor Adopt Henry George Single Tax Plank

The Knights of Labor General Assembly adopted Henry George's single tax as the fourth plank in the platform. The assembly also urged census reforms to include information of interest to laborers. The General Executive Board was granted broader political influence.

Exiled Brazilian Emperor Departs as Republic Proclaimed

The Brazilian monarchy is toppled and Dom Pedro and his family leave Petropolis and sail for Lisbon after accepting a pension and cash offer. The new Republic assigns provinces, adopts a green and gold flag with 19 stars, and pledges to honor state contracts..docs

Alien Labor Law Enforcement Near Detroit

Treasury reports complaints that Canadian importers cross the border daily to perform labor in the United States. Secretary Batchellor confirms the action and vows enforcement under the Alien Labor Law.
